White-boy retro-soul, long on attitude and stomp, short on subtlety.
And the question almost asks itself: are we talking Dexy's Midnight Runners or Southside Johnny and the Asbury Jukes? The answer, contrary to what you might expect (given that Dee is from Boston, not Wolverhampton), is Dexy's: the energy is antsy, the voice shrill, the horns choral. The writing, however, is workmanlike and although young Jesse is obviously meaning every word of it, man, the result is still an exercise in fevered mannerism. Nice try.
